Open synaptic package manager. Bottom left highlight status, top left highlight installed then top right under quick filter search for the word nvidia. It will return several results. I would suggest the best one to go with is nvidia-kernel-dkms. So highlight this and then top left click Package/Force version. you should see the current nvidia driver in that list. Highlight it and install it. If you don't see it under the dkms package try the nvidia-glx package instead.
